As climate commitments among large financial institutions have rapidly become the new normal, so has the criticism of those targets.

exposed the financing reality of large banks since 2016 and found fossil fuel financing to be on an upward trend despite the COVID-induced decreases in 2020. Since many of the top financiers mentioned in such reports have set climate commitments, their credibility is rightly being questioned.World Benchmarking Alliance

found that out of 400 financial institutions studied, less than 2% had interim targets that covered all financing activities. This lack of coverage restricts how much a target will likely achieve. If only lending activities are on track to be Paris-aligned, for example, other financing activities running at business-as-usual have the potential to diminish progress.

It has become clear that the progress being made isn’t quite enough. Given all the gaps being exposed along the way, greenwashing has become a main concern when we look deeper at financial institutions’ commitments.there is increasing scrutiny on greenwashing.

As 2030 looms, we are reaching the point where it is imperative to see a distinguishable change in the way financial institutions operate if they claim to be on the road to net zero. To start, targets should be updated to address as many of the lingering concerns as possible. Additionally, it is up to these institutions to publish clearthat show how they will implement their commitments from here on out.
